In all the hoo-hah recently about busty barmaids being banned by the EU, a sly remark by the Sun slipped through my net:
We vowed to give big-boobed barmaids all the support they would need to beat the ban. It was due to be rubber-stamped by the EU parliament next month under the Optical Radiation Directive."Oh? Why "rubber-stamped"?! The European Parliament rarely, if ever, lets through a Commission proposal unamended - unlike our own dear House of Commons, which almost always approves government bills. Don't knock the democratic part of the EU!
